odbc_autocommit — Toggle autocommit behaviour
Toggles autocommit behaviour.
By default, auto-commit is on for a connection. Disabling auto-commit is equivalent with starting a transaction.
odbcThe ODBC connection identifier, see odbc_connect() for details.
enable
       If enable is true, auto-commit is enabled, if
       it is false auto-commit is disabled.
       If null is passed, this function returns the auto-commit status for
       odbc.
      
   With a null enable parameter, this function returns
   auto-commit status for odbc. Non-zero is
   returned if auto-commit is on, 0 if it is off, or false if an error
   occurs.
  
   If enable is non-null, this function returns true on
   success and false on failure.
